Using the script below I found 219469 tracks of which 202630 did not have a
motorcar= tag.
My reasoning behind gosmore was that tracks not suitable for vehicles should
be tagged as footway. It's flawed because we so many unsurfaced way types.
Perhaps we can adopt the following scheme ?
highway=track defaults to motorcar=no
highway=unsurfaced defaults to motorcar=yes
highway=byway defaults to motorcar=yes
bzcat germany.osm.bz2 | awk '/<way.*id.*timestamp.*>/ { print hway, motor;
hway=""; motor=""}; /<.*highway.*track.*>/ { hway="t" }; /<.*motorcar.*>/
{motor=$0}' |grep '^t'|sort |less -S

> I am wondering, if there is a default for motorcar defined for
> highway=track
> if motorcar=yes/no is not specified explicitly.
>
> In Germany (Switzerland and Austria as well?) there are probably a very low
> fraction of tracks on which motorcars are allowed.
>
> This seems to be different in other countries, gosmore at least routes cars
> over tracks. I am wondering if the default can be per country....or how
> much
> work it is to give all tracks a motorcar tag.
>
> Can anybody find out easily how many tracks there are in Germany without an
> motorcar tag?
